What is Paid Advertising?

Paid advertising refers to any kind of advertising that involves a financial transaction to promote a product, service, or brand message. It's a fundamental tactic in digital marketing that involves placing marketing materials on various platforms, often with a pay-per-click (PPC), cost-per-thousand impressions (CPM), or cost-per-acquisition (CPA) model. The primary goal of paid advertising is to increase visibility, drive traffic, and ultimately boost conversions by reaching a broader audience than would be possible organically.

In today's digital landscape, paid advertising spans across numerous channels, including search engines, social media platforms, and display networks. Each platform offers unique advantages, targeting opportunities, and analytics features that allow marketers to tailor their campaigns to their specific goals and audience demographics.

Types of Paid Advertising

Paid advertising can be categorized into several types, each with distinct features and benefits suited for various campaign objectives:

  • Search Engine Advertising: Involves bidding for ad placements in a search engine's sponsored section. Google Ads is the most popular platform for search ads, targeting users based on specific query keywords.
  • Social Media Advertising: Platforms like Facebook, Instagram, and LinkedIn offer ad services that allow businesses to reach users based on specific age, interests, and behavioral demographics, enhancing brand engagement.
  • Display Advertising: Utilizes visuals on websites, videos, or apps. These banner ads are effective for brand awareness, as they are highly visible among website visitors.
  • Retargeting: A strategy that targets users who have previously interacted with your brand online but did not convert, using cookies to serve up ads that remind and entice them back.
  • Video Advertising: Platforms like YouTube offer marketers a chance to use video content to promote products or services, appealing directly to the user's emotions and preferences.

Strategies for Effective Paid Advertising

Creating an impactful paid advertising strategy involves several key components:

  • Clear Objectives: Define what you want to achieve, such as brand awareness, lead generation, or sales conversions, and tailor your campaigns accordingly.
  • Target Audience Definition: Leverage data analytics to understand who your ideal customer is and use platform-specific targeting to reach them efficiently.
  • Budget Management: Allocate your advertising budget wisely, balancing between high ROI opportunities and brand goals.
  • Ad Creatives: Develop compelling and high-quality ad content that resonates with your audience. This could include eye-catching visuals, persuasive copy, or engaging videos.
  • Continuous Optimization: Utilize data insights to refine and adjust your strategies, ad placements, and spending, ensuring maximum efficiency and effectiveness of your campaigns.
